1. One Touch buttons
Store and recall up to eight fax and telephone numbers.
To access stored One Touch fax and telephone numbers 1-4, press the One Touch button
assigned to that number. To access stored One Touch fax and telephone numbers 5-8, hold
down (Shift) as you press the number.
2. Fax buttons
Redial/Pause
Press to dial the last numbers you called. This button also inserts a pause when
programming quick dial numbers or when dialling a number manually.
Hook
Press Hook before dialing to ensure a fax machine answers, and then press Start.
If the machine is in Fax/Tel (F/T) Mode and you pick up the handset of an external
telephone during the F/T ring (pseudo double-rings), press Hook to talk.
